User-Agent: Build Identifier: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; U; Linux i686; en-US; rv:1.5) Gecko/20031007 Firebird/0.7 Note "http//" with the colon missing is not a typo. "http://" alerts you to "The URL is not valid and cannot be loaded." I would think the same should be true for, "http//" This is also true for version .8 of Firefix on the Windows platform.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Type http// into address bar and hit "return" 2. 3. Actual Results: The browser loades http://microsoft.com/ Expected Results: It should alert you the URL is invalid.

Firefox is treating it as a search keyword. If you enter search terms in the address field, Firefox will return the result of a "I'm Feeling Lucky" search at Google. And if you do such a search for 'http//' at Google, the first result is microsoft.com.
